Crismon Creek is a smaller community of families located just east of the 202 and south of the 60 on the eastern edge of Mesa, Arizona!. Prime location only nine miles from Gold Canyon and hiking trails galore, 20 minutes from Canyon Lake and Saguaro Lake for boating, skiing and fishing; one mile from a new hospitalMountain Vista Medical Center; five miles east of Superstition Springs Mall; adjacent to the Mesa Swap Meet and the new Superstition Gateway Center at Signal Butte and Baseline.

Crismon Creek is a community of approximately 350 homes including three parks, retention basins
